Community overview based on MLS listing data for Drexel Lake, Columbia

The community’s defining feature is right in the name: lakefront living, with at least one home offering a private dock and broad water views. Add in mature trees, generous yards, and lot sizes that feel noticeably larger than the typical in-town parcel, and the neighborhood has a relaxed, established character that is hard to miss.

The homes here are primarily single-family residences, with a clear mid-century footprint. The oldest known home dates to 1965, and the newest to 1984, which gives the neighborhood a cohesive, well-rooted look rather than a patchwork of eras. Many homes feature basement space, and one recent listing highlighted a flexible lower-level setup that could function as an in-law suite. That kind of adaptable layout shows up often in the way these homes are described: practical, spacious, and ready for personalization.
Brick is part of the story as well, though not every home is finished that way. At least one listing specifically called out an all-brick ranch, which adds to the neighborhood’s classic curb appeal. Across the board, the homes lean toward comfort and utility, with open living areas, oversized decks, sunrooms, and room to spread out.
Drexel Lake’s everyday appeal comes from the land and the water. A private dock, waterfront views, and a bright sunroom create a setting that feels made for slow mornings and easy evenings. The lots are substantial, the backyards are deep, and mature trees soften the edges of the neighborhood. It is the kind of place where the outdoor space is just as important as the house itself.

Drexel Lake sits in Columbia’s northeast side, with Fort Jackson and Interstate 77 called out in nearby location remarks. That puts the community within reach of major military, commuting, and shopping corridors while still feeling removed from heavier traffic. Public remarks also mention proximity to interstates, schools, and shopping, which helps explain the area’s practical convenience.
School assignments point to Windsor Elementary, Wright Middle, and Richland Northeast High. For buyers comparing Columbia neighborhoods, that school path and the neighborhood’s northeast Columbia setting give Drexel Lake a clear local identity: established homes, lake views, and straightforward access to the city’s key routes and services.
